Re: HP ProLiant MicroServer with Windows 8.1 upgrade
I solved this on my unit by:
1. diabling the braodcom LAN after windows 8.1 was downloaded in the store just before it wanted to reboot.
2. Using PCIex LAN card and just pretending the on board ethernet port never existed.
I had also updated my AMD video driver software.
@OdexSA wrote:I need assistance please. I have a HP Proliant Microserver (64bit) BIOS: HP O41 09/30/2010 running Windows 8 as OS (32bit) . I'm trying to upgrade to Windows 8.1 but it fails. The error code relates to an outdated BIOS. How do I get the right BIOS version to upgrade?
